Overview of materials for PBT + ASA Blend, Glass Fiber Reinforced
Categories: Polymer; Thermoplastic; ASA Polymer; Polyester, TP; Polybutylene Terephthalate (PBT); PBT + ASA Blend, Glass Fiber Reinforced

Material Notes: This property data is a summary of similar materials in the MatWeb database for the category "PBT + ASA Blend, Glass Fiber Reinforced". Each property range of values reported is minimum and maximum values of appropriate MatWeb entries. The comments report the average value, and number of data points used to calculate the average. The values are not necessarily typical of any specific grade, especially less common values and those that can be most affected by additives or processing methods.

Physical PropertiesMetricEnglishComments
Density 1.25 - 1.57 g/cc0.0452 - 0.0567 lb/in³Average value: 1.41 g/cc Grade Count:53
 1.19 - 1.42 g/cc
@Temperature 225 - 250 °C
0.0430 - 0.0513 lb/in³
@Temperature 437 - 482 °F
Average value: 1.30 g/cc Grade Count:8
Filler Content 15.0 - 30.0 %15.0 - 30.0 %Average value: 24.2 % Grade Count:12
Water Absorption 0.0600 - 0.780 %0.0600 - 0.780 %Average value: 0.544 % Grade Count:10
Moisture Absorption at Equilibrium 0.100 - 0.400 %0.100 - 0.400 %Average value: 0.206 % Grade Count:21
Water Absorption at Saturation 0.200 - 0.400 %0.200 - 0.400 %Average value: 0.355 % Grade Count:11
Viscosity Test 92.0 - 110 cm³/g0.920 - 1.10 dl/gAverage value: 104 cm³/g Grade Count:6
Maximum Moisture Content 0.02000.0200Average value: 0.0200 Grade Count:4
Linear Mold Shrinkage 0.00100 - 0.0120 cm/cm0.00100 - 0.0120 in/inAverage value: 0.00354 cm/cm Grade Count:44
 0.00300 - 0.00400 cm/cm
@Temperature 80.0 - 80.0 °C
0.00300 - 0.00400 in/in
@Temperature 176 - 176 °F
Average value: 0.00350 cm/cm Grade Count:2
Linear Mold Shrinkage, Transverse 0.00200 - 0.0110 cm/cm0.00200 - 0.0110 in/inAverage value: 0.00713 cm/cm Grade Count:35
 0.00700 - 0.00800 cm/cm
@Temperature 80.0 - 80.0 °C
0.00700 - 0.00800 in/in
@Temperature 176 - 176 °F
Average value: 0.00750 cm/cm Grade Count:2
Melt Flow 5.72 - 55.0 g/10 min5.72 - 55.0 g/10 minAverage value: 23.2 g/10 min Grade Count:48
 
Mechanical PropertiesMetricEnglishComments
Ball Indentation Hardness 140 - 157 MPa20300 - 22800 psiAverage value: 149 MPa Grade Count:3
Tensile Strength, Ultimate 45.0 - 135 MPa6530 - 19600 psiAverage value: 99.8 MPa Grade Count:45
 35.0 - 115 MPa
@Temperature -40.0 - 100 °C
5080 - 16700 psi
@Temperature -40.0 - 212 °F
Average value: 70.0 MPa Grade Count:1
Tensile Strength, Yield 75.0 - 132 MPa10900 - 19200 psiAverage value: 111 MPa Grade Count:10
Elongation at Break 1.50 - 9.00 %1.50 - 9.00 %Average value: 3.16 % Grade Count:45
Elongation at Yield 2.00 - 8.00 %2.00 - 8.00 %Average value: 3.21 % Grade Count:8
Modulus of Elasticity 2.90 - 10.5 GPa421 - 1520 ksiAverage value: 7.25 GPa Grade Count:44
Flexural Yield Strength 60.0 - 193 MPa8700 - 28000 psiAverage value: 150 MPa Grade Count:34
Flexural Modulus 2.50 - 9.32 GPa363 - 1350 ksiAverage value: 6.13 GPa Grade Count:28
Flexural Strain at Yield 2.50 - 3.20 %2.50 - 3.20 %Average value: 2.72 % Grade Count:5
Poissons Ratio 0.340 - 0.3500.340 - 0.350Average value: 0.343 Grade Count:9
Izod Impact, Notched 0.686 - 0.800 J/cm1.29 - 1.50 ft-lb/inAverage value: 0.764 J/cm Grade Count:3
Izod Impact, Notched (ISO) 5.50 - 45.0 kJ/m²2.62 - 21.4 ft-lb/in²Average value: 11.3 kJ/m² Grade Count:21
 7.00 - 33.0 kJ/m²
@Temperature -30.0 - -30.0 °C
3.33 - 15.7 ft-lb/in²
@Temperature -22.0 - -22.0 °F
Average value: 11.1 kJ/m² Grade Count:10
Izod Impact, Unnotched (ISO) 6.00 - 50.0 kJ/m²2.86 - 23.8 ft-lb/in²Average value: 41.5 kJ/m² Grade Count:14
 6.00 - 50.0 kJ/m²
@Temperature -30.0 - -30.0 °C
2.86 - 23.8 ft-lb/in²
@Temperature -22.0 - -22.0 °F
Average value: 41.0 kJ/m² Grade Count:11
Charpy Impact Unnotched 2.50 - 6.40 J/cm²11.9 - 30.5 ft-lb/in²Average value: 4.66 J/cm² Grade Count:42
 1.00 - 6.50 J/cm²
@Temperature -40.0 - -30.0 °C
4.76 - 30.9 ft-lb/in²
@Temperature -40.0 - -22.0 °F
Average value: 3.83 J/cm² Grade Count:26
Charpy Impact, Notched 0.300 - 1.00 J/cm²1.43 - 4.76 ft-lb/in²Average value: 0.732 J/cm² Grade Count:38
 0.200 - 1.00 J/cm²
@Temperature -40.0 - -20.0 °C
0.952 - 4.76 ft-lb/in²
@Temperature -40.0 - -4.00 °F
Average value: 0.636 J/cm² Grade Count:22
Tensile Creep Modulus, 1 hour 6500 - 9500 MPa943000 - 1.38e+6 psiAverage value: 8130 MPa Grade Count:4
Tensile Creep Modulus, 1000 hours 3300 - 7400 MPa479000 - 1.07e+6 psiAverage value: 5760 MPa Grade Count:5
 
Electrical PropertiesMetricEnglishComments
Electrical Resistivity 1.00e+15 - 1.00e+16 ohm-cm1.00e+15 - 1.00e+16 ohm-cmAverage value: 2.19e+15 ohm-cm Grade Count:16
Surface Resistance 1.00e+14 - 5.00e+15 ohm1.00e+14 - 5.00e+15 ohmAverage value: 6.87e+14 ohm Grade Count:16
Dielectric Constant 3.40 - 4.703.40 - 4.70Average value: 3.78 Grade Count:13
Dielectric Strength 20.0 - 117 kV/mm508 - 2970 kV/inAverage value: 34.5 kV/mm Grade Count:10
Dissipation Factor 0.00175 - 0.02100.00175 - 0.0210Average value: 0.0108 Grade Count:11
Comparative Tracking Index 125 - 550 V125 - 550 VAverage value: 311 V Grade Count:17
 
Thermal PropertiesMetricEnglishComments
CTE, linear 20.0 - 55.0 µm/m-°C11.1 - 30.6 µin/in-°FAverage value: 32.6 µm/m-°C Grade Count:14
CTE, linear, Transverse to Flow 70.0 - 100 µm/m-°C38.9 - 55.6 µin/in-°FAverage value: 91.0 µm/m-°C Grade Count:10
Specific Heat Capacity 1.85 - 1.90 J/g-°C
@Temperature 225 - 250 °C
0.442 - 0.454 BTU/lb-°F
@Temperature 437 - 482 °F
Average value: 1.88 J/g-°C Grade Count:4
Thermal Conductivity 0.250 - 0.280 W/m-K
@Temperature 225 - 250 °C
1.74 - 1.94 BTU-in/hr-ft²-°F
@Temperature 437 - 482 °F
Average value: 0.260 W/m-K Grade Count:5
Melting Point 220 - 260 °C428 - 500 °FAverage value: 226 °C Grade Count:36
Maximum Service Temperature, Air 110 - 170 °C230 - 338 °FAverage value: 155 °C Grade Count:4
Deflection Temperature at 0.46 MPa (66 psi) 120 - 220 °C248 - 428 °FAverage value: 196 °C Grade Count:33
Deflection Temperature at 1.8 MPa (264 psi) 90.0 - 220 °C194 - 428 °FAverage value: 168 °C Grade Count:44
Vicat Softening Point 110 - 215 °C230 - 419 °FAverage value: 161 °C Grade Count:21
Glass Transition Temp, Tg 120 °C248 °FAverage value: 120 °C Grade Count:8
Flammability, UL94 HB - 5VAHB - 5VAGrade Count:30
Flame Spread 13.3 - 80.0 mm/min0.524 - 3.15 in/minAverage value: 42.3 mm/min Grade Count:5
Oxygen Index 19.0 - 27.0 %19.0 - 27.0 %Average value: 23.7 % Grade Count:7
Glow Wire Test 525 - 960 °C977 - 1760 °FAverage value: 858 °C Grade Count:3
 
Processing PropertiesMetricEnglishComments
Processing Temperature 80.0 - 270 °C176 - 518 °FAverage value: 125 °C Grade Count:4
Nozzle Temperature 245 - 277 °C473 - 530 °FAverage value: 256 °C Grade Count:6
Melt Temperature 235 - 280 °C455 - 536 °FAverage value: 258 °C Grade Count:41
Mold Temperature 26.7 - 130 °C80.0 - 266 °FAverage value: 79.6 °C Grade Count:42
Drying Temperature 80.0 - 120 °C176 - 248 °FAverage value: 109 °C Grade Count:33
Moisture Content 0.000 - 0.0800 %0.000 - 0.0800 %Average value: 0.0304 % Grade Count:23
